What Makes a Nursery School Curriculum Effective?
Introduction A solid and interesting nursery school curriculum is essential for laying a strong foundation for a child's early education. It promotes mental , emotional, social, and physical development while making learning enjoyable and meaningful. But what makes a nursery school curriculum effective? Let’s explore the key elements of a high-quality early childhood education program. 1. A Child-Centered Learning Approach The nursery curriculum focuses on child-centered learning. This means the curriculum is designed around young learners' interests, needs, and developmental stages. Instead of a rigid structure, it allows flexibility so children can explore and learn at their own pace. Activities encourage curiosity, creativity, and critical thinking, making learning a natural and enjoyable process. 2. Play-based learning Play is the primary way children learn in their early years.
